Q: Is 3,726,692 a Prime Number?
A: No, 3,726,692 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 3726692 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 421 842 1,684 2,213 4,426 8,852 931,673 1,863,346 and 3,726,692, with no remainder.
Since 3,726,692 cannot be divided by just 1 and 3,726,692, it is not a prime number.
